Removing yourself from the drama. There is drama in these types of situations. I have actively suggested that my sister go Plan B with her WxH. Almost every other day, she is calling me about some situation, which if it went through an IM, she wouldn't even know the extent of. I have suggested that she even go to emails only, but I think a part of her thrives on the drama.

Also, you would begin to personally recover much more quickly if you didn't have interactions with your WxW. You would feel much more peace and be able to focus on the well being of your children.

There are MANY xBSs that have Plan B's their xWSs after a D on these boards, and there are many more who could greatly benefit from it.

I would suggest it to you.

And besides, if you did start to date in the future, you shouldn't have any contact with your WxW, so you may as well start now.
